SmartBike DC - A Bike Sharing Program in Washington, DC

SmartBike DC offers a new way to get around Washington, DC. The self-service bicycle rental system offers an annual membership of $40.00 and allows you to swipe a card and release a bike from a kiosk for short trips through the city. SmartBike DC, a new program provided by the District Department of Transportation (DDOT) in partnership with Clear Channel, is the first of its kind in the United States. Similar bike sharing programs have operated successfully in Paris, Lyon, Barcelona and Oslo.

The environmentally friendly transportation option is expected to be used by mostly local residents and commuters who are familiar with how to navigate the city streets. SmartBike DC will initially offer 120 bikes at 10 locations in the heart of the city. The bikes can be returned to any of the kiosk locations. One rental may not exceed three consecutive hours. If a bicycle is not returned within 24 hours after rental, the member is charged a fee of $550. SmartBike DC kiosks will operate daily from 6 a.m. to 10 p.m.

SmartBikes are equipped with chainguards, a basket/rack on the front for briefcases, purses, or groceries, etc., 3 gears, and adjustable, comfortable seats. Members must supply their own helmet and lock. The District does not currently have a helmet law for adults, but strongly encourages all members to wear a helmet when riding a bike.

SmartBike DC Kiosk Locations

Logan Circle
14th St, NW & Rhode Isl. the and Ave, NW

Metro Center
12th St, NW & G St, NW

Dupont Circle
Q St, NW & Connecticut Ave, NW

Reeves Center
14th St, NW & U St, NW

Shaw
7th St, NW & T St, NW

Foggy Bottom
23rd St, NW & I St, NW

Martin Luther King Library (Gallery Place)
9th St, NW & F St, NW

Gallery Place Metro
9th St, NW & F St, NW

McPherson Square
14th St, NW & I St, NW

Convention Center
7th St, NW & Mt. Vernon Place, NW
